"The Complete Works of Emile Zola" is an extensive collection that brings together the masterful literary contributions of the renowned French author Emile Zola. This anthology encompasses Zola's notable novels, including "Therese Raquin," "Germinal," "Nana," and the monumental "Rougon-Macquart" cycle.
Zola's works are characterized by their meticulous realism, unflinching social commentary, and vivid portrayal of human struggles. In "Therese Raquin," he delves into the dark realms of passion, guilt, and remorse. "Germinal" offers a powerful exploration of the harsh realities faced by miners and the social injustices of the 19th-century industrial world.
"Nana" presents a mesmerizing character study of a seductive and destructive courtesan, while the "Rougon-Macquart" cycle spans twenty novels, interweaving the lives of various characters to create a panoramic depiction of French society during the Second Empire.
